Provider Score in 02837, Little Compton, Rhode Island

The Provider Score for the Breast Cancer Score in 02837, Little Compton, Rhode Island is 36 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

An estimate of 96.22 percent of the residents in 02837 has some form of health insurance. 39.08 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 83.92 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ase. Military veterans should know that percent of the residents in the ZIP Code of 02837 have VA health insurance. Also, percent of the residents receive TRICARE.

For the 455 residents under the age of 18, there is an estimate of 1 pediatricians in a 20-mile radius of 02837. An estimate of 0 geriatricians or physicians who focus on the elderly who can serve the 1,234 residents over the age of 65 years.

In a 20-mile radius, there are 1,275 health care providers accessible to residents in 02837, Little Compton, Rhode Island.

The foundation of effective breast cancer care often begins with a strong primary care network. Primary care physicians (PCPs) serve as the initial point of contact, providing preventative screenings, early detection, and referrals to specialists. In Little Compton, the availability of PCPs is a crucial factor. Assessing the number of practicing PCPs within the ZIP code and the surrounding areas is the first step. A low number of PCPs, or a high patient-to-physician ratio, can lead to delayed appointments, reduced access to preventative care, and ultimately, potentially hinder early detection of breast cancer.

The physician-to-patient ratio is a key metric. A higher ratio, indicating fewer physicians per capita, can strain the healthcare system. This can result in longer wait times for appointments, less time spent with each patient, and potentially reduced quality of care. Researching the average patient load per PCP in the area is essential to understanding the accessibility of primary care. This information, combined with the total population of Little Compton, provides a clearer picture of the healthcare resource availability.

Beyond the basic numbers, identifying standout practices within the region is important. These practices may be recognized for their commitment to patient care, their advanced screening technologies, or their focus on patient education. Researching local practices and their reputations is essential. This might involve looking at patient reviews, checking for accreditations (such as those from the American College of Radiology for imaging facilities), and assessing the range of services offered. Practices that prioritize preventative care, offer comprehensive breast health services, and have a strong track record of patient satisfaction deserve recognition.

Telemedicine has become increasingly important in healthcare delivery, particularly in rural areas. Its adoption can significantly improve access to care, especially for those with mobility issues or limited transportation options. Assessing the availability of telemedicine services for breast cancer-related care is crucial. This includes whether PCPs and specialists offer virtual consultations, remote monitoring, and online patient portals. Telemedicine can facilitate follow-up appointments, provide access to specialists outside of Little Compton, and offer educational resources.

The emotional and psychological impact of a breast cancer diagnosis and treatment is profound. Therefore, the integration of mental health resources into the care pathway is essential. Evaluating the availability of mental health professionals, such as therapists and counselors, who specialize in oncology or women's health is crucial. This includes assessing whether these resources are integrated into the primary care practices or specialist offices. The presence of support groups, both in-person and online, can also provide invaluable emotional support for patients and their families.
